							Etymology: Gambusia: Gambusia: From the Cuban term, Gambusino, which means "nothing", usually in the context of a joke or a farce. Fishing for gambusinos = when one catches nothing (Ref. 45335).

					Freshwater; brackish;  benthopelagic; pH range: 6.5 - 7.8; dH range: ? - 18. Tropical; 22°C - 26°C (Ref. 2060)				
				 
			
			
			
				
				
				
					North America:  Rio Nautla, northern Veracruz, Mexico, along the Atlantic slope of Campeche, Atlantic drainage of inland Mexico in the states of Oaxaca and Chiapas, presumably across the base of the Yucatan Peninsula to Quintana Roo, south to southern Belize (Moho river drainage).  Also found in the Rio Usumacinta drainage in Guatemala, and in isolated islands in the Petén region.

 Max length : 2.6 cm SL male/unsexed; (Ref. 30499); 3.5 cm SL (female)				
				 
			
			
			
			
			
			
			
			
				Usually found near the shore where vegetation is present in both pond and river habitats.  Feeds mainly on benthic, vegetation-associated invertebrates, and on terrestrial shoreline organisms.

				After about 28 days gestation, female gives birth to 10-35 young. Sexual maturity is reached after four months (Ref. 2060).
